Islam: From Its Origins to the Rise of the Ottoman Empire – Claude Cahen – Dvir, 1995 – 490 pp. - An authoritative survey by renowned French historian Claude Cahen (1909–1991), one of the foremost scholars of medieval Islamic history. This volume traces the development of Islam from its emergence in the seventh century through the beginning of the Ottoman Empire in the late fifteenth century. Cahen examines the rapid expansion of Islam, the rise of the caliphates, and the political, social, economic, military, and cultural evolution of the Islamic world. Combining original scholarship with a clear and accessible narrative, the book provides a balanced overview of one of history’s most influential civilizations and its interactions with Byzantium, Europe, and neighboring regions. The Hebrew edition includes photographs, maps, a bibliography, and an index, making it an excellent reference for students, researchers, and anyone interested in Islamic, Middle Eastern, and medieval history.
